We are seeking a skilled Microsoft 365 Administrator to join our IT team. This role is critical in managing and optimizing our Microsoft 365 environment, ensuring seamless collaboration, security, and productivity across the organization. The ideal candidate requires expertise in Microsoft 365, Exchange Online, Intune, and related collaboration tools, and a passion for delivering exceptional support and service with internal and external customers.

Key Responsibilities

  • MS 365 Administration:
    • Manage and maintain the global Microsoft 365 tenant, including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, Teams, OneDrive, Intune, and Azure Active Directory.
    • Implement and manage role-based access control (RBAC) and user permissions.
    • Implement and enforce governance, compliance, and security policies across the M365 ecosystem.
    • Monitor system health, usage, and performance, and proactively address issues.
    • Configure and manage Intune for mobile device management (MDM) and mobile application management (MAM).
    • Develop and enforce device compliance policies and configuration profiles.
    • Monitor and troubleshoot device enrollment and compliance issues.
    • Manage application deployment and updates for mobile devices.
  • Level 1-3 Support:
    • Serve as the contact point for all M365-related incidents and other service requests through Jira.
    • Troubleshoot and resolve advanced issues related to identity, access, mail flow, Teams collaboration, and device management.
    • Collaborate with internal support teams and external vendors to resolve critical incidents.
  • Automation & Optimization:
    • Develop and maintain PowerShell scripts for automation, reporting, and bulk operations.
    • Identify opportunities to streamline processes and enhance user experience.
  • Project Involvement:
    • Lead or support M365-related projects, including migrations, integrations, and feature rollouts.
    • Provide technical guidance and best practices to project teams and stakeholders.
  • Documentation & Training:
    • Maintain up-to-date documentation of configurations, procedures, and support materials.
    • Provide training and knowledge transfer to IT support teams and end-users.
  • IT Operations:
    • Monitor and maintain IT asset inventory, ensuring proper tracking and lifecycle management of hardware and software.
    • Work with IT team members to ensure compliance with IT security policies and procedures.
    • Support IT projects, including software rollouts, system upgrades, and process improvements.

Qualifications

  • At least 3 years in a Microsoft 365 administration role.
  • Proven experience handling Level 3 support tickets in a global enterprise environment.
  • Strong expertise in:
    • Microsoft Exchange Online
    • Microsoft Teams and SharePoint Online
    • Azure Active Directory and Conditional Access
    • Microsoft Intune and Endpoint Manager
    • PowerShell scripting
  • Microsoft certifications (e.g., MS-102, AZ-104, or equivalent) are highly desirable.
  • Excellent problem-solving, communication, and documentation sk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.
